115 Eaton Square, London, SW1W 9AA is a freehold terraced property built before 1900. The property offers approximately 9,343 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have six b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£9,241,161 , which equates to approximately £989 per square foot. It was last sold on 15 Jun 2007 for £4,400,000. Since then, the value has increased by £4,841,161, representing a 110.0% increase, or approximately 5.9% per year.

115 Eaton Square, London, City Of Westminster, Greater London Authority, SW1W 9AA has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 1 Nov 2016.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ows have partial double gl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 1 Oct 2010,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 68.6%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from average to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The hot water energy efficiency improving from average to good, while the system remained as from main system.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from flat, no insulation (assumed) to flat, insulated, impro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ed) to solid brick, with internal insulation, impro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to partial double gl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
